Odisha CM to Hold Grievance Cell in Sambalpur on April 21

Chief Minister Mohan Charan Majhi will hold a Grievance Cell on April 21, 2025, in Sambalpur, providing a crucial opportunity for citizens to voice their concerns.


The event will take place at the Mahanagar Nigam Office, Durgapali, where up to 1,000 applicants will have a chance to present their grievances directly to the CM.

The registration will start tomorrow, on April 17, at 11 AM. Citizens can submit complaints via the grievance portal or the mobile application.

As many as 1,000 registered applicants can meet the Chief Minister from 8 AM on 21st April and express their grievances.

This initiative aims to address general administrative matters and public concerns, ensuring that governance remains accessible and responsive to the needs of the people.
